Sedative and analgesic effect of Butorphanol-xylazine-ketamine anesthesia in rabbits

Author(s): Sawant Rutuja, Patil Harshal, Gajendra Khandekar, Santoshmani Tripathi, Dishant Saini and Tanaji Mane
Abstract: This study was conducted to evaluate the effects of intramuscular (IM) administration of Butorphanol-Xylazine-Ketamine combination for diagnostic and surgical procedures in rabbits. Five rabbits were included in present study undergoing surgical procedures. Basic physiological parameters, analgesic and sedative scores were recorded at 0, 10, 20, 30, 40, 60. Single intramuscular injection of butorphanol (0.1 mg/kg)-xylazine (5 mg/kg)-ketamine (15 mg/kg) was given. The parameters like rectal temperature (RT), depth and rate of respiration (RR), heart rate (HR), oxygen saturation (Spo2) and reflexes were recorded. Butorphanol found to improve sedation and postoperative analgesia of xylazine-ketamine combination in rabbits.
